What will you cover throughout the course?
We’ll start from “What is a Network?” moving to “How the DNS works?” then to “How the Subnets and VLAN work?” and much more. We’ll not stop there, after you’re done analyzing all this, later in the course, you’ll learn how the 4-way Wi-Fi Handshake works.
Upon completion of this course, you will be able to understand the following:
